Conversions run on direct factors drawn from internationally recognized standards. Length uses 1 inch = 2.54 cm and 1 meter = 3.28084 feet; weight uses 1 pound = 0.453592 kg and 1 kg = 2.20462 pounds. Volume relies on 1 US gallon = 3.78541 liters and 1 liter = 0.264172 US gallons, while temperature follows °F = (°C × 9/5) + 32 and °C = (°F - 32) × 5/9.

Watch which imperial unit you're targeting, since US customary and British imperial values diverge on measures like the gallon. Significant figures deserve attention too: the converter returns precise numbers, but physical measurements carry their own limits of accuracy, and rounding can compound when you chain several conversions back to back.

How many centimeters in an inch?
One inch equals exactly 2.54 centimeters. To convert inches to centimeters, multiply by 2.54. To convert centimeters to inches, divide by 2.54.
How do you convert Celsius to Fahrenheit?
Multiply the Celsius temperature by 9/5, then add 32. For example, 20°C = (20 × 9/5) + 32 = 68°F.
How many liters in a gallon?
One US gallon equals approximately 3.785 liters. One imperial (UK) gallon equals approximately 4.546 liters. Always check which gallon standard is being used.
